
SMITH: Peacefully, at London Health Sciences Centre – Victoria Hospital, London, on Thursday, November 24, 2022, Robert Kirk Smith of Grand Bend, age 68. Beloved husband of 48 years to Catharina “Cathy” Johanna (VanAlphen) Smith. Loved father and father-in-law of Mandy and Chris Emery of Woodstock. Dear brother and brother-in-law of Susan and John Summers of Strathroy, Cheryle Gardiner of Owen Sound, Rebekah and Richard Regier of London, John and Mary VanAlphen of Thamesford, Martin and Lynda VanAlphen of British Columbia, Johanna and Ron Granville of Thorndale. Remembered by his many nieces, nephews and their families. Kirk will be missed by his canine sidekick Bella. Predeceased by his parents George Patrick (2015) and Muriel Fern (Richardson) Smith (2016) and brother-in-law Bev Gardiner (2002). At Kirk’s request, cremation has taken place and no formal services will be held. Private interment Pinery Cemetery, Grand Bend. Kirk worked in roofing for over 50 years, with Smith Peat Roofing and with his dad for Bluewater Roofing. Arrangements entrusted to the T. Harry Hoffman & Sons Funeral Home, Dashwood. If desired, memorial donations (payable directly) to the London Regional Cancer Clinic or a charity of your choice would be appreciated by the family.
